Steven Smith, a Yale professor and expert on Leo Strauss, joins for an enlightening discussion on Strauss’s impact on political philosophy. They dive into the East vs. West Coast Straussians debate and explore fusionism's potential. The conversation delves into the complexities of the Great Man Theory, while also dishing out some intriguing gossip about 20th-century intellectuals. Smith clarifies Strauss's key philosophies, examining the balance of faith and skepticism, and the ideological shifts within modern conservatism.

Strauss on Philosophy's Quest

  • Leo Strauss focused on philosophy as a quest for the best way of life against historicism and positivism.
  • He viewed philosophy as an ongoing search, not culminating in final answers.
INSIGHT

Esoteric Writing in Philosophy

  • Strauss argued philosophers use esoteric writing to protect dangerous ideas from persecution.
  • This idea challenges straightforward interpretation and complicates trust in philosophical texts.
INSIGHT

Jerusalem vs Athens Tension

  • Strauss viewed Western thought as a tension between faith (Jerusalem) and philosophy (Athens).
  • He believed sustaining a dialogue between these poles is vital to Western civilization.
